Hurricanes and Tornadoes That Hit Greensburg, KY

Every tropical system within 75 miles since 1851 and every tornado within 25 miles since 1950.

7 tropical systems have passed within 75 miles of Greensburg, Kentucky since 1851, 0 of them at hurricane strength; the most recent was Helene in 2024. Since 1950, 77 tornadoes have touched down within 25 miles, 10 of them rated EF3 or stronger.

Strength is the sustained wind on the track at the closest point, which is not the wind felt in Greensburg: a hurricane's worst winds sit within a few dozen miles of its centre, and inland cities are usually past that.

How to read this page

A storm is listed when the centre of its track passed within 75 miles of Greensburg while it was at least a tropical storm, which is the reach of damaging wind and rain for a typical hurricane. Being on the list does not mean the city took a direct hit; the "closest" column says how near the centre came. Tornadoes are counted when any part of the path came within 25 miles.

Tornado records before the 1990s are thinner, because weak tornadoes in open country often went unreported before Doppler radar and mobile phones. A rise in the decade counts is mostly better reporting, not a change in the weather.

Tracks come from the National Hurricane Center's HURDAT2 database, tornadoes from the Storm Prediction Center's database. Both are the official federal records and both are revised as old storms are re-analysed.
